The Surface Pro 2-in-1 is built for those who need both a laptop and a tablet in one versatile device. Powered by the Snapdragon X Elite chip, with a robust 12-core setup, it’s designed to tackle everything from productivity tasks to creative work and even light gaming. With 16GB of RAM and 512GB of storage, it’s well-equipped for multitasking, whether you’re working on documents, running multiple apps, or diving into media creation. The 13-inch OLED touchscreen is a standout, offering a 1M:1 contrast ratio for vibrant colors and deep blacks. This, combined with the 5G connectivity, makes it a perfect choice for mobile professionals who need fast, reliable internet and high-quality visuals.

In terms of real-world usage, the Surface Pro shines with its all-day battery life. With up to 14 hours on a single charge, it easily gets through a full day of office work or media consumption. Of course, when it’s time to recharge, the 65W fast charging via Surface Connect or USB-C means you can top up quickly and get back to work. Its lightweight design, at just under 2 pounds, makes it incredibly portable, easily fitting into most bags for on-the-go use.

Now, let’s talk about the performance. The Snapdragon X Elite processor offers impressive power, especially in AI-enhanced tasks. Whether you’re running intensive apps or using the built-in Copilot+ AI features for smart assistance, it’s clear that this chip is designed for modern workloads. Day-to-day, it’s smooth sailing for productivity tasks—web browsing with many tabs, running office apps, or even video conferencing. For creative work like photo or video editing, the 16GB of RAM ensures smooth performance without slowdown. For light gaming, while not a dedicated gaming machine, it can handle less demanding titles at decent settings, but it’s not going to rival dedicated gaming laptops.

One of the standout features is the OLED display. With the high contrast ratio, the screen is ideal for streaming video, providing vivid colors and deep blacks that bring media to life. The touchscreen functionality adds another layer of convenience, whether you’re sketching, taking notes, or browsing. It’s especially useful in tablet mode when the detachable keyboard is removed, offering a completely touch-based experience.

When it comes to thermals, the Surface Pro does a solid job of staying cool under normal use. The Snapdragon X Elite chip is energy-efficient, meaning you won’t experience the heating issues that often come with higher-power Intel or AMD chips. The fan noise is minimal, so it’s perfect for quiet environments like libraries or meetings. However, under heavier tasks like extended video editing or gaming, the device does heat up a bit, but it never gets uncomfortably hot, which is impressive for such a slim design.

As for the keyboard and trackpad, they’re comfortable for light typing and general use. The detachable Surface Pro Flex Keyboard, sold separately, offers a responsive typing experience, though it’s not the best for extended typing sessions. The trackpad is responsive and accurate, making navigation smooth and easy. However, if you’re using it as a tablet, the onscreen keyboard works well, but it’s not quite as efficient for heavy typing compared to a traditional laptop.

With its 5G connectivity, you’ll get blazing-fast internet speeds, provided you have a suitable data plan. This feature is great for users who need to stay connected while traveling or working remotely. It also supports Wi-Fi 6, ensuring fast and stable connections when you’re on a wireless network.

In terms of ports, the Surface Pro includes a USB-C port, a Surface Connect port, and a headphone jack. While it’s not as expansive as some other laptops, it covers the essentials, and the inclusion of 5G and USB-C gives you solid connectivity options for modern peripherals. The device doesn’t have an HDMI port or an SD card reader, which could be a drawback for some users who need to connect to external displays or transfer data from cameras.

If you’re considering alternatives, the Apple MacBook Air M3 (2024) is a close competitor, with similar performance and battery life, but it lacks the 5G connectivity and the OLED display. The Dell XPS 13 2-in-1 is another competitor, offering more ports and a powerful Intel chip, though it’s heavier and doesn’t feature the same level of AI integration or display quality.
